M1X Global, a sovereign financial infrastructure company, closed an oversubscribed Seed funding round led by Paradigm with participation from Breed VC, bringing total funding to $8.5 million. The funds will support the development and institutional rollout of USDM1, the first USD-denominated sovereign bond natively issued on a public blockchain by the Marshall Islands, secured 1:1 by US Treasuries. The round closed 14 weeks after M1X Global's public launch and angel raise. Paradigm's investment reflects growing conviction in sovereign blockchain infrastructure. M1X Global partners with governments to bridge the transition to 24/7 programmable capital markets. USDM1 has been used in institutional working groups with major financial institutions including Bank of America, Citadel Securities, Virtu Financial, Tradeweb, and DTCC. The founding team includes CEO Mark Lurie, COO Dan Goldman, and Robert Muller.
